As technology continues to shape our digital landscape, Dreamweaver stands out as a powerful tool in the realm of web development. Often revered for its seamless integration of design and code, Dreamweaver bridges the gap between creativity and functionality, making it a staple for both novice and seasoned programmers alike. In this article, we delve into the intricate workings of Dreamweaver, demystifying the programming language that drives its magic.
Unlock the secrets behind Dreamweaver as we explore its unique features and capabilities, shedding light on how it streamlines the web development process. Whether you’re a budding web designer or a seasoned programmer, understanding the language behind Dreamweaver is essential in harnessing its full potential and crafting captivating websites with ease.
The Origins And Evolution Of Dreamweaver
Dreamweaver, a web development tool known for its user-friendly interface and powerful features, has a rich history that dates back to its origins in the late 1990s. Originally developed by Macromedia, Dreamweaver quickly became a popular choice among web designers and developers for its ability to create visually appealing websites with ease. Over the years, Dreamweaver has evolved to keep up with changing web technologies and trends, making it a staple in the web development community.
The acquisition of Macromedia by Adobe in 2005 brought Dreamweaver into the Adobe Creative Suite, further solidifying its position as a leading web design software. With each new version released, Dreamweaver has introduced innovative tools and enhancements to streamline the web development process. From its early days of basic HTML editing to the sophisticated features for responsive design and integration with popular content management systems, Dreamweaver continues to adapt and innovate to meet the demands of modern web development.
Understanding Html, Css, And Javascript In Dreamweaver
In Dreamweaver, a popular web development tool, having a solid grasp of HTML, CSS, and JavaScript is essential for creating dynamic and visually appealing websites. HTML (Hypertext Markup Language) is the backbone of web content, providing structure and defining elements on a webpage. With Dreamweaver, users can easily manipulate HTML code through its intuitive interface, allowing for quick edits and adjustments.
CSS (Cascading Style Sheets) is used to enhance the presentation and layout of a website, controlling elements such as fonts, colors, and spacing. Dreamweaver simplifies the process of working with CSS by offering built-in tools for styling web pages efficiently. Users can create and customize stylesheets directly within the program, making it easier to manage the design aspects of their websites.
JavaScript, a dynamic programming language, adds interactivity to web pages by allowing for functions and behaviors to be executed based on user interactions. Dreamweaver supports JavaScript integration, enabling developers to enhance the functionality of their websites by incorporating interactive elements like dropdown menus, sliders, and forms. Understanding how HTML, CSS, and JavaScript work together within Dreamweaver is key to unlocking its full potential for web development projects.
Integrating Php And Mysql In Dreamweaver
Integrating PHP and MySQL in Dreamweaver allows developers to create dynamic and interactive websites with ease. Dreamweaver’s built-in support for PHP and MySQL simplifies the process of connecting the front-end user interface with a back-end database. By using Dreamweaver’s intuitive interface and visual tools, developers can seamlessly integrate PHP scripts to interact with MySQL databases directly within the program.
With the ability to write and edit PHP code within Dreamweaver’s code editor, developers can efficiently manage server-side scripting for dynamic web content. The integration also provides features like database connectivity and recordsets for querying and displaying data from MySQL databases. This integration empowers developers to build robust web applications that can store and retrieve data dynamically, offering a more personalized and engaging user experience.
Overall, integrating PHP and MySQL in Dreamweaver streamlines the development process and enhances the functionality of websites by enabling the creation of dynamic content that responds to user interactions. Whether building e-commerce platforms, content management systems, or interactive web applications, leveraging PHP and MySQL integration in Dreamweaver opens up a world of possibilities for creating dynamic and data-driven websites.
Responsive Design Features In Dreamweaver
Dreamweaver comes equipped with a robust set of responsive design features that enable developers to create websites that adapt seamlessly to various screen sizes and devices. One of the key tools for achieving responsive design in Dreamweaver is the Bootstrap framework integration. This allows users to easily build responsive layouts using pre-designed components and grid systems, saving time and effort in the development process.
Additionally, Dreamweaver offers media query support, which allows developers to customize styles based on different screen sizes. With the ability to preview and test designs in real-time across multiple devices directly within the Dreamweaver interface, users can ensure that their websites look great on desktops, tablets, and smartphones. This visual approach to responsive design simplifies the process and empowers developers to create dynamic and user-friendly websites that provide a seamless experience for all visitors.
Advanced Features And Tools In Dreamweaver
Advanced Features and Tools in Dreamweaver elevate web development to a whole new level. One such feature is the Code Navigator, a powerful tool that allows users to easily navigate through complex code structures within their projects. This tool simplifies the process of editing and managing code, enhancing productivity and efficiency for developers.
Integration of Git for version control is another advanced feature in Dreamweaver that enables seamless collaboration among team members. With Git integration, developers can track changes, manage versions, and work on projects concurrently without the risk of conflicting edits. This feature streamlines the workflow and ensures project consistency and reliability.
Furthermore, Dreamweaver offers a range of CSS preprocessor support, including SASS and LESS, allowing developers to write cleaner and more maintainable CSS code. By utilizing these preprocessor tools, developers can easily organize stylesheets, reuse code snippets, and create dynamic styles, ultimately enhancing the aesthetics and functionality of their web projects.
Troubleshooting And Debugging In Dreamweaver
Troubleshooting and debugging in Dreamweaver are essential skills for any developer navigating the complexities of web design. When encountering issues within your code, Dreamweaver offers robust tools to identify and rectify errors efficiently. Utilizing the built-in real-time syntax checker can instantly flag syntax errors, helping you pinpoint and correct mistakes before they escalate.
In addition to syntax checking, Dreamweaver provides a powerful debugging feature that allows you to step through your code line by line, inspecting variables and expressions to pinpoint the root cause of any issues. By utilizing breakpoints strategically, you can control the flow of your program, making it easier to identify logic errors and unexpected behavior within your code.
Furthermore, Dreamweaver offers integration with popular browser developer tools, enabling you to test and troubleshoot your web pages directly within the browser environment. By leveraging these debugging capabilities within Dreamweaver, developers can streamline their workflow and ensure the optimal performance of their web projects.
Accessibility And Seo Optimization In Dreamweaver
In Dreamweaver, accessibility and SEO optimization play crucial roles in ensuring that your website not only looks great but also performs well in search engine rankings and is accessible to all users.
When it comes to accessibility, Dreamweaver offers features that help you create websites that are user-friendly for individuals with disabilities. From adding alt text to images for screen readers to ensuring a logical structure with proper heading tags, Dreamweaver provides tools to enhance the accessibility of your website.
On the SEO front, Dreamweaver equips you with features to optimize your website for search engines. You can easily customize meta tags, create SEO-friendly URLs, and analyze your site’s performance to improve its visibility in search engine results. By focusing on accessibility and SEO optimization in Dreamweaver, you can enhance the user experience, reach a wider audience, and improve your website’s overall performance.
Harnessing Dreamweaver For Efficient Web Development
Leveraging Dreamweaver for efficient web development involves mastering its robust features to streamline your workflow. By utilizing built-in tools like code hinting, syntax highlighting, and auto-formatting, you can enhance your coding efficiency and accuracy. Dreamweaver’s integrated FTP capabilities allow for seamless file management, enabling you to upload, edit, and update your website files directly from the software.
Furthermore, Dreamweaver’s responsive design features empower you to create websites that adapt fluidly across different devices and screen sizes. Utilizing grid layouts, flexible box sizing, and media query support, you can ensure your websites are visually appealing and functional on desktops, tablets, and smartphones. By harnessing Dreamweaver’s pre-built templates and libraries, you can expedite the development process and focus more on customizing and refining your web projects to meet specific client needs.
Frequently Asked Questions
What Is Dreamweaver And How Is It Used In Web Development?
Dreamweaver is a popular web development tool created by Adobe that allows users to design, code, and manage websites visually. It provides a user-friendly interface for building websites without needing to write code manually. Dreamweaver supports coding languages like HTML, CSS, and JavaScript, making it easy for developers to create responsive and dynamic web pages. Overall, Dreamweaver streamlines the web development process by offering a range of tools and features to help designers and developers create engaging websites efficiently.
Can Beginners Learn Dreamweaver Without Prior Programming Knowledge?
Yes, beginners can learn Dreamweaver without prior programming knowledge as it is a user-friendly web design software that offers a visual interface for creating websites. Dreamweaver provides templates and drag-and-drop features that make it accessible to beginners who may not have coding experience. Additionally, there are online tutorials and resources available to help beginners learn how to use Dreamweaver effectively and create professional-looking websites. With dedication and practice, beginners can quickly pick up the basics of Dreamweaver and start designing websites without needing extensive programming knowledge.
What Are The Key Features And Tools In Dreamweaver For Creating Websites?
Dreamweaver offers a range of key features and tools for creating websites, including a visual design interface for creating layouts, a code editor for writing and editing HTML, CSS, and JavaScript code, and a built-in FTP client for uploading files to a web server. Additionally, Dreamweaver provides access to pre-built templates, responsive design tools for creating mobile-friendly websites, and integration with Adobe Creative Cloud services for seamless workflow management. Overall, Dreamweaver is a comprehensive web design software that caters to both beginners and experienced web developers with its intuitive interface and powerful features.
How Does Dreamweaver Help Streamline The Web Development Process?
Dreamweaver helps streamline the web development process by offering a visual interface for designing websites, allowing developers to create layouts and designs without having to write extensive code manually. It provides a wide range of pre-built templates and components that can be easily customized and integrated into the project, saving time and effort. Additionally, Dreamweaver’s code editor offers features like syntax highlighting, code completion, and debugging tools that help developers write clean and error-free code efficiently, speeding up the development process. Overall, Dreamweaver simplifies web development by providing a comprehensive set of tools and features in a user-friendly environment.
Are There Any Tips For Mastering Dreamweaver Programming Language Efficiently?
To master Dreamweaver efficiently, take advantage of online tutorials and resources to deepen your understanding of the program’s features and functionalities. Practice regularly by working on small projects, experimenting with different tools and techniques. Additionally, join online forums and communities to engage with peers and seek advice on coding challenges. Continuous learning and hands-on experience will help you become proficient in Dreamweaver programming language.
The Bottom Line
Understanding the intricacies of Dreamweaver’s programming language is a valuable asset for both seasoned developers and newcomers to web design. By demystifying the code that powers this powerful tool, users gain a deeper appreciation for the endless possibilities it offers in creating stunning websites with ease. Embracing the underlying language behind the magic of Dreamweaver provides an empowering foundation for unleashing creativity and innovation in web development projects. As technology continues to evolve, mastering Dreamweaver’s programming language equips individuals with the skills needed to stay ahead in the dynamic digital landscape, paving the way for limitless opportunities to bring ideas to life on the web.